| Harro Koskinen | Harro! A Classic of Finnish Pop Art
The exhibition introduces Harro Koskinen's (born in 1945 in Turku) work from his Pop Art period. Harro was one of the wittiest and most sharp-sighted artists in Finland in the 1960s and the 1970s, and his artistic production caused active opposition both by the conservative public and the bodies of power. | Anete Melece receives recognition at Tallinn Illustration Triennial
Latvian artist Anete Melece received the Best Illustrator Diploma at the Tallinn Illustration Triennial for her illustrations for the book "Nepareizas dzīves skola" ("Wrong Life School") by author Maira Dobele, published at "Liels un mazs" publishing house in 2008.
